Cardiff City transfer news: Bluebirds closing in on deal to sign Krystian Bielik

Cardiff City are closing in on the signing of centre-half Krystian Bielik from Championship side West Bromwich Albion on a permanent deal.

The 28-year-old made 17 Championship appearances for the Baggies last season as they finished 21st, narrowly avoiding relegation to League One.

The experienced defender joined Arsenal from Legia Warsaw in 2015 and had spells with Birmingham City, Walsall, Charlton Athletic and Derby County prior to joining West Brom last summer.

Bielik would be Cardiff’s fourth senior summer recruit following the arrivals of goalkeeper Nathan Trott, midfielder Jack Moylan and left-back Calum Scanlon, who has returned to the Welsh capital on loan from Liverpool.

Poland international Bielik would be a welcome signing for the Bluebirds, who are currently without a fit central defender in their ranks.

Will Fish, Dylan Lawlor, Calum Chambers and Gabriel Osho are all currently injured, although the latter is thought to be close to a return to action.

The Bluebirds gave a debut to 15-year-old defender Noah Anyadike – who became the youngest player in EFL Cup history – during their 2-1 loss against Norwich City in the second round on Tuesday night.

Bielik could potentially make his Cardiff debut when they host Chris Wilder’s Sheffield United on Saturday (15:00 BST).
